The video discusses the initiative to help consumers identify high-sodium items in restaurant menus using specific icons. It explains that consuming more than 2300 milligrams of sodium in a day can lead to increased blood pressure, raising the risk of heart attacks and strokes. The focus is on providing information for informed dietary choices, emphasizing transparency and the potential health impacts of sodium.
